The Limitations of Traditional Multi-Coin ETFs

Traditional multi-coin ETFs have long been touted as a bridge between traditional finance and crypto markets. However, their structure is inherently constrained by the regulatory environments in which they operate. For instance, many platforms enforcing these ETFs require minimum investments of $50K to $200K, effectively excluding retail investors and limiting geographic accessibility due to securities laws. Additionally, redemption processes are often tied to daily NAV calculations, leading to delays during periods of market stress.

These ETFs also rely on intermediaries-custodians, compliance teams, and centralized exchanges-to manage assets, which introduces friction in settlement times and inflates operational costs. While these models comply with existing financial regulations, they lack the agility to adapt to the fast-paced, decentralized nature of crypto markets. As noted in a comparative analysis, traditional ETFs prioritize stability over innovation, often at the expense of liquidity and investor flexibility.

CMC20's On-Chain Model: A Paradigm Shift

CMC20, launched on the BNB Chain, redefines diversified crypto exposure by eliminating intermediaries and leveraging blockchain's inherent transparency. The index token tracks the top 20 cryptocurrencies by market capitalization (excluding stablecoins) and is designed for both institutional and retail investors. Its architecture, built on Reserve Protocol and Lista DAO, enables real-time minting, redemption, and tracking of the index, with cross-chain support via Celer Network ensuring seamless exposure across ecosystems as reported by blockonomi.

Key advantages of CMC20 include:
1. Cost Efficiency: By operating on BNB Chain, a network known for low transaction fees and high liquidity, the token reduces overhead costs associated with custody and settlement.
2. Accessibility: Unlike traditional ETFs, CMC20 requires no accreditation or minimum investment thresholds, democratizing access to diversified crypto exposure.
3. Institutional Flexibility: Features like delta-neutral strategies and collateralized lending cater to sophisticated investors, while retail users benefit from one-tap diversification as highlighted by livebitcoinnews.
4. Transparency: On-chain minting and redemption via the Reserve dApp ensure full visibility into the index's composition, a stark contrast to the opaque processes of traditional ETFs.

Navigating Regulatory Uncertainty

While traditional ETFs operate under well-defined regulatory frameworks (e.g., SEC oversight), CMC20 exists in a more fluid environment. This lack of clarity, however, is not a drawback but a feature. By design, CMC20's on-chain model is self-sovereign and adaptable, allowing it to evolve alongside regulatory developments without requiring costly restructurings. For instance, the token's exclusion of stablecoins and focus on top-20 assets align with conservative risk management principles, potentially easing future regulatory scrutiny.

Critics argue that crypto's volatility poses a higher risk profile compared to traditional ETFs. Yet, this volatility is inherent to the asset class itself, not the vehicle. CMC20 mitigates this by offering diversified exposure across multiple high-cap cryptocurrencies, reducing the impact of any single asset's underperformance as analyzed in a comparative study. In contrast, traditional ETFs often face restrictions on asset inclusion, limiting their ability to capture the full spectrum of crypto innovation.
